First Baseball Practice in Cage

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

Thirteen candidates reported yesterday afternoon to Dr. Sexton for the first battery practice this year in the baseball Cage. After a preliminary warming up and a short batting practice the pitchers were given a short try-out. Dr. Sexton then devoted the remainder of the time to showing the catchers how to play their position.

The following thirteen men reported: R. C. Babson '12, J. R. Baker '13, J. C. P. Bartholf '13, G. F. Bird '13, G. F. Davis '13, S. M. Felton '13, E. C. Hardy '13, P. D. Howe '11, R. G. McKay '11, H. E. Ohler '11, H. E. Reeves '12, J. A. Sweetser '11, S. Woodward '12.
